That’s Him! That’s The Guy!
Our second Michigan band is the awesomely titled That’s Him! That’s The Guy! may sound like some large indie twee pop collective, but instead, it’s just two guys with four first names. Joseph Scott and David Martin are “a sort of folk duo”, a vague yet accurate description of what they do.
They make pretty stripped down, personal songs, but they still know how to bust out the instruments when they are called for. Over their six song EP, ‘Help Me, I’m On Fire’, they manage to make use of keyboards, a banjo, a glockenspiel (what’s with those lately?), a harmonica and a bunch of other fun stuff you wouldn’t usually expect from two seemingly miserable guys with guitars. The songs themselves are personal to the point of grimace, with brutal honesty winning the day here (”These days when I wake up / I don’t tell myself that I’m not gonna drink / Cause I know a lie when I hear one”) being delivered by half pained, half shouty vocals.

‘Help Me, I’m On Fire’ can be purchased for the absurdly cheap sum of $5 from the band’s website. They are currently in the studio recording a full length album, tentatively titled ‘The Army Life’. Demos from these studio sessions can be heard on their Myspace.
